在服务器开发中,选择合适的编程语言是构建高性能系统的基础。不同的语言在处理并发、内存管理和执行效率上各有优势。例如,C++和Go在底层性能上有明显优势,而Python则更适合快速开发和复杂逻辑处理。开发者应根据项目需求、团队熟悉度以及生态支持来做出合理选择。
函数的高效调用直接影响服务器的响应速度和资源利用率。避免冗余函数调用,合理使用内联函数或缓存结果,可以减少不必要的计算开销。同时,设计清晰的函数接口,有助于提高代码可维护性,降低调试和优化成本。

AI模拟效果图,仅供参考
变量的精细管理是提升服务器稳定性和性能的关键。过度使用全局变量可能导致状态混乱,而局部变量则能减少作用域污染。•及时释放不再使用的资源,如内存和文件句柄,有助于防止内存泄漏和系统资源耗尽。
优化代码结构和逻辑流程,能够进一步提升服务器的整体效率。通过减少嵌套、避免重复计算和合理使用数据结构,可以显著改善程序运行效率。同时,良好的代码注释和文档编写,也能为后续维护和协作提供便利。
综合来看,服务器开发的核心在于平衡性能、可维护性和可扩展性。合理选择语言、优化函数调用和精细化管理变量,是打造高效可靠服务器的重要保障。